分类

HTML转Markdown转换器

将HTML内容转换为Markdown格式,支持自定义转换选项

关键信息

分类
Format Conversion
输入类型
textarea, checkbox
输出类型
text
样本覆盖
4
支持 API
Yes

概览

HTML转Markdown转换器是一款高效的在线工具,旨在帮助开发者、内容创作者和技术文档编写者将复杂的HTML代码快速转换为简洁的Markdown格式,支持灵活的自定义转换选项以满足不同排版需求。

适用场景

  • 需要将网页内容迁移到支持Markdown的博客平台或文档系统时。
  • 在编写技术文档时,需要将现有的HTML代码片段转化为易于阅读的Markdown标记语言。
  • 需要批量清理HTML标签并提取纯文本内容,同时保留基础的链接、列表和表格结构时。

工作原理

  • 在输入框中粘贴您需要转换的HTML代码。
  • 根据需求勾选转换选项,例如是否保留链接、图像、表格或列表结构。
  • 点击转换按钮,系统将自动解析HTML并生成对应的Markdown文本。
  • 复制生成的Markdown代码,直接粘贴到您的编辑器中使用。

使用场景

将网页文章快速转换为Markdown格式,以便发布到GitHub或静态网站生成器。
从CMS系统中导出HTML内容,并将其转换为Markdown格式进行本地备份或编辑。
将复杂的HTML表格数据转化为简洁的Markdown表格,方便在文档中展示。

用户案例

1. 博客文章迁移

技术博主
背景原因
博主需要将旧版网站的HTML文章迁移到新的Markdown博客系统。
解决问题
手动删除HTML标签并添加Markdown语法非常繁琐且容易出错。
如何使用
将HTML文章内容粘贴到输入框,勾选“Convert Links”和“Convert Lists”,点击转换。
示例配置
convertLinks: true, convertLists: true, removeEmptyLines: true
效果
快速获得格式整洁的Markdown文本,直接复制即可发布。

2. 技术文档整理

开发人员
背景原因
开发人员需要将API文档的HTML片段转换为Markdown格式,以便放入README.md中。
解决问题
HTML表格在Markdown中难以手动重写。
如何使用
输入包含表格的HTML代码,确保勾选“Convert Tables”选项,进行转换。
示例配置
convertTables: true, preserveWhitespace: false
效果
HTML表格被准确转换为Markdown表格语法,完美嵌入README文件。

用 Samples 测试

html, markdown, image

相关专题

常见问题

HTML转Markdown转换器是免费的吗?

是的,该工具完全免费使用,无需注册即可进行转换。

转换过程中会丢失样式吗?

Markdown主要关注内容结构,因此HTML中的CSS样式和内联样式通常不会被保留,仅保留文本内容和基础结构。

支持转换复杂的嵌套表格吗?

支持,工具会将HTML表格标签转换为标准的Markdown表格语法,但过于复杂的嵌套结构可能会被简化。

我可以选择不转换图片吗?

可以,您可以通过取消勾选“Convert Images”选项来忽略HTML中的图片标签。

转换后的Markdown代码可以自定义格式吗?

您可以利用工具提供的选项(如保留空格、移除空行等)来微调输出结果,以符合您的排版习惯。

API 文档

请求端点

POST /zh/api/tools/html-to-markdown

请求参数

参数名 类型 必填 描述
htmlInput textarea -
convertLinks checkbox -
convertImages checkbox -
convertTables checkbox -
convertLists checkbox -
preserveWhitespace checkbox -
removeEmptyLines checkbox -

响应格式

{
  "result": "Processed text content",
  "error": "Error message (optional)",
  "message": "Notification message (optional)",
  "metadata": {
    "key": "value"
  }
}
文本: 文本

AI MCP 文档

将此工具添加到您的 MCP 服务器配置中:

{
  "mcpServers": {
    "elysiatools-html-to-markdown": {
      "name": "html-to-markdown",
      "description": "将HTML内容转换为Markdown格式,支持自定义转换选项",
      "baseUrl": "https://elysiatools.com/mcp/sse?toolId=html-to-markdown",
      "command": "",
      "args": [],
      "env": {},
      "isActive": true,
      "type": "sse"
    }
  }
}

你可以串联多个工具,比如:`https://elysiatools.com/mcp/sse?toolId=png-to-webp,jpg-to-webp,gif-to-webp`,最多20个。

如果遇见问题,请联系我们:[email protected]